Transaction 20bd97929130149b9643b1382452b8de8e8e11e19d21c1d17eadf0409e96d1bc
1 Input
1 Output
-
20bd97929130149b9643b1382452b8de8e8e11e19d21c1d17eadf0409e96d1bc:0
- value
- 18758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c18cc9c90dec6f4406dee9bcf7337a2c1aea6ae7 OP_EQUAL
- address
- 3KLQzhocPRkusme17pbrPVCpkN7HCVmpf9